How News Affects Bitcoin's Price: The Mechanisms
1. The Immediate Impact of Headlines
Bitcoin reacts faster to news than traditional assets. A single tweet from Elon Musk or a regulatory announcement can trigger 10-20% price swings within hours.
2. Three Major News Categories That Move Markets
| News Type | Typical Impact | Duration |
|---|---|---|
| Regulatory | High volatility | Short-term |
| Technological | Moderate | Medium-term |
| Economic | Gradual | Long-term |
3. The Role of Market Sentiment
Positive news creates FOMO (Fear of Missing Out), while negative news triggers sell-offs. This emotional trading pattern explains Bitcoin's notorious volatility.
Analyzing News Impact: The Methodology
Step 1: Data Collection
Researchers gather:
- Financial news articles
- Social media buzz
- Regulatory announcements
- Market analysis reports
Step 2: Natural Language Processing
Advanced NLP techniques include:
- Tokenization (breaking text into analyzable units)
- Sentiment scoring (positive/negative tone detection)
- Topic modeling (identifying recurring themes)

Case Studies: News Events That Shook Bitcoin
1. The Mt. Gox Hack (2014)
- Event: Major exchange hack
- Result: 50% price drop
- Lesson: Security news dramatically affects confidence
2. China's Mining Ban (2021)
- Event: Government crackdown
- Result: 30% decline
- Recovery: 6 months to stabilize
3. ETF Approvals (2023-24)
- Event: Institutional investment news
- Result: Gradual price increases
- Takeaway: Positive regulatory news builds long-term value
FAQs: Understanding News-Driven Volatility
Q: How quickly does Bitcoin price react to news?
A: Often within minutes - much faster than stocks or commodities.
Q: Which news sources most impact Bitcoin?
A: Regulatory announcements and tech/business media (Coindesk, Bloomberg Crypto) have strongest correlation.
Q: Can news analysis predict Bitcoin prices?
A: While not perfect, sentiment analysis provides reliable short-term indicators.
Q: Why does bad news sometimes increase Bitcoin's price?
A: During economic crises, Bitcoin often benefits as a "hedge asset."
Q: How do long-term investors handle news volatility?
A: Many use dollar-cost averaging to smooth out news-driven fluctuations.

Protecting Your Investments in a News-Driven Market
- Diversify Your Sources: Follow both crypto-native and traditional financial news
- Understand the Context: Distinguish between hype and substantive developments
- Use Technical Indicators: Combine news analysis with chart patterns
- Set Stop-Losses: Protect against sudden news-triggered drops
- Watch Trading Volume: High volume confirms genuine news impact
The Future of News and Bitcoin Prices
As institutional adoption grows, Bitcoin may become:
- Less reactive to minor news
- More responsive to macroeconomic trends
- Better correlated with traditional financial indicators
Yet its fundamental volatility from major events will likely persist, maintaining both risks and opportunities for savvy investors.
